#191e4f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#191e4f is composed of 9.8% red, 11.8%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.4% cyan, 62% magenta, 0%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 234.4 degrees, a saturation of 51.9% and a lightness of 20.4%. #191e4f color hex could be obtained by blending #323c9e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#191e4f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#191e4f has RGB values of R:25, G:30,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 1646159.
